一 下载docker开发镜像  Docker hub提供了一个用于docker组件自动化编译的镜像docker-dev,这个镜像自带了docker源码docker源码编译所依赖的各种环境资源。但是这个镜像目前不再随着docker源码更新,这个镜像自带docker最新的版本为1.9.1,如果需要编译更新的docker源码,需要进行一定的适配。   镜像的pull命令:
转载 11月前
112阅读
文章目录概述安装构建预备知识启用 BuildKit概述示例应用程序测试应用程序为 Python 创建一个 Dockerfile目录结构构建一个镜像查看本地镜像标记镜像总结运行预备知识概述以分离模式运行列出容器停止、启动和命名容器总结开发预备知识简介在容器中运行数据库将应用程序连接到数据库使用 Compose 进行本地开发总结配置预备知识建立一个 Docker 项目设置 GitHub Action
转载 2023-07-11 19:48:08
217阅读
像下载、域名解析、时间同步请点击 阿里巴巴开源镜像站一、Linux环境开发适用于Linux环境开发者,有专门代码服务器或虚拟机1. 安装docker$ sudo apt-get install docker-ce2. 获取docker镜像$ docker pull registry.cn-hangzhou.aliyuncs.com/alios_things/rtos:latest3. 启
转载 9月前
234阅读
1.什么是Docker?Go语言开发,容器虚拟化技术,C/S架构,具有隔离、快速、轻便的特点。 Docker是容器的一种,容器指的是:一种轻量级、可移植、自包含的软件打包技术,使应用程序可以在几乎任何地方以相同的方式运行。2.Docker与虚拟机有何不同?相比于虚拟机,docker更快速、轻便。 快速:秒级启动 轻便:联合文件系统 Docker容器是一种轻量级的虚拟化技术,目的和虚拟机一样,都
转载 10月前
83阅读
基于docker v1.12的源代码,对docker engine v1.11中重构后的源码结构进行分析,涵盖dockerd, containerd, containerd-shim, runC。docker1.11新特性docker在v1.11版本进行了重大的重构,对docker engine和container进行了解耦,docker engine运行在containerd上,containe
转载 2月前
53阅读
## DOCKER THINGSBOARD: 使用Docker部署ThingsBoard 在物联网领域,ThingsBoard是一个流行的开源平台,用于连接和监控设备。通过使用Docker,我们可以轻松地部署ThingsBoard,并快速搭建起一个可靠的物联网系统。 ### Docker简介 Docker是一个开源的容器化平台,可帮助开发人员轻松地打包、交付和运行应用程序。它使用容器来封装应
原创 5月前
64阅读
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录前言一、编译环境二、编译过程1.编译2.注意1.查找整个项目文件,把pom.xml中的node版本和yarn版本替换成你自己本地的版本号。2.如果报错显示有些依赖下载不了尝试修改git:3.采用的maven镜像如下:4.在C:\Users\用户名下创建pkg-cache文件夹5.yarn安装6.如果遇到UI-ngx相关的编译
摘要: 此文档安装系统为win7 64位,因为使用虚拟机,所以安装软件位置都为C盘,涉及到编译时会有权限问题,和造成电脑很卡,建议大家不要安装在C盘!!!! 1. 依赖工具2. 源码调试 2.1 源码拉取2.2 源码编译2.3 IDE(编译器)导入3. 数据源处理4. 登录ThingBoard1、依赖工具      —JDK   
本章将介绍ThingsBoard的本地环境搭建,以及源码编译安装。本机环境:jdk1.8、postgresql-12.2-2-windows-x64、maven 3.6.2、node v12.18.2、idea 2020.1、redis 3.2。环境安装开发环境要求:Jdk 1.8 版本 ;Postgresql 9 以上;Maven 3.6 以上;Git 工具;Idea 开发工具;Redis;N
转载 2020-11-17 18:15:21
2782阅读
docker-compose.yml内容:version: '2.2'services: mytb: restart: always im
原创 2022-01-19 14:07:32
774阅读
_TYPE: in-memory # volumes: # - mytb-da
原创 2021-07-05 17:44:49
2060阅读
gdb 7.X 下载编译(aarch64) 文章目录gdb 7.X 下载编译(aarch64)1. gdb源码下载2. 交叉编译工具下载2.1 搜索支持的工具版本:2.2 下载安装:2.3 安装完成后查看gcc版本确认是否安装成功3 编译3.1 aarch64 结构的gdb(7.12)3.2 aarch64 结构的gdb(7.9)3.3 编译在x86下运行的gdb程序(解析aarch64体系cor
转载 3月前
40阅读
获取二开ThingsBoard物联网平台演示 ThingsKit物联网平台官网:https://www.thingskit.com/ 环境安装 开发环境要求:Jdk 1.8版本Postgr
# Docker 部署 ThingsBoard ## 什么是 DockerDocker 是一个开源的容器化平台,它可以将应用程序及其依赖项打包到一个标准化的容器中,以便在不同的环境中进行部署和运行。Docker 的容器化技术可以提供更高的灵活性、可移植性和可扩展性,使得部署和管理应用程序变得更加简单和高效。 ## 什么是 ThingsBoardThingsBoard 是一个开源的物
原创 8月前
195阅读
# ThingsBoard Docker部署 物联网(IoT)是一个充满无限可能的领域,连接和管理大量设备是物联网系统的核心。ThingsBoard是一个开源的物联网平台,可以帮助用户快速搭建和管理其物联网解决方案。 在本文中,我们将介绍如何使用Docker部署ThingsBoard。 ## Docker简介 Docker是一个开源的容器化平台,可以帮助开发人员将应用程序和其依赖项打包到一
原创 2023-07-21 21:59:32
767阅读
为什么会在centos7上编译docker的代码呢?因为我们准备在线上使用centos7来运行docker,并且我们需要自己维护docker的代码版本。下面就自己在编译代码过程中遇到的问题和解决方案做简单说明。在编译docker代码之前肯定需要研究一下docker的代码结构以及官方推荐的方式,因为docker是开源的,所以很多第三方开发者参与。那么官方肯定会给出开发环境搭建的文档,所以拿到代码肯定
本章将介绍ThingsBoard的本地环境搭建,以及源码编译安装。本机环境:centos7,docker
原创 2月前
101阅读
## Docker部署ThingsBoard ### 什么是DockerDocker是一个开源的容器化平台,可以轻松地将应用程序及其依赖项打包到一个可移植的容器中。这些容器可以在各种操作系统上运行,提供了一种方便、可靠的部署方式。 ### 为什么要使用Docker? 使用Docker可以带来许多好处,包括: - **快速部署**:Docker容器可以在几秒钟内启动和停止,大大加快了部
原创 2023-08-25 15:00:11
552阅读
本章将介绍ThingsBoard的本地环境搭建,以及源码编译安装。本机环境:centos7,docker
# Docker安装Thingsboard教程 ## 概述 在这篇文章中,我将向你展示如何使用Docker来安装ThingsboardThingsboard是一个开源的物联网平台,用于连接设备并收集、处理和可视化设备生成的数据。使用Docker可以帮助简化安装过程,并提供可靠的、一致的环境。 在接下来的内容中,我将按照以下步骤来教会你如何安装Thingsboard: 1. 安装Docker
原创 2023-08-21 03:38:30
936阅读
1点赞
  • 1
  • 2
  • 3
  • 4
  • 5